Bingo, again…again?
July 31, 2008The Ferriday town council — or at least, three of the members of the town council — have called a meeting to discuss the introduction of an electronic bingo ordinance for Thursday night. Supposedly, they wanted to move the venue to the Arcade Theater to accomodate the expected large number of people in attendance, but DA candidate Andy Magoun will be having a campaign rally there, so the meeting will be at the Ferriday Town Hall as usual.
It’s interesting that three of the members want to revisit the issue so soon after the last public hearing, which was more like a public flaying of the guys who proposed the idea by everyone from ministers to a woman who said she would rather pick cotton on her knees than see bingo in town. What will be more interesting is what they actually do during the meeting — after all, three council members is enough to pass an ordinance.
Edit: After a lot of hemming and hawing and a good deal of public outrage at the meeting, none of the town council members could bring themselves to introduce the motion that would have allowed bingo in. Not only was the meeting a waste of time, but it effectively killed bingo indefinitely.
